Three Graces, Shanghai



The Three Graces on the Bund in Shanghai, China, were modelled on the originals on the waterfront in Liverpool by wealthy Western businessmen and developers who began to commercialise China from the late 1880s onwards.

The middle building here is an obvious pastiche of the Liver Building, facing the Princes Landing Stage on Merseyside. 

Night image taken from a vessel on the Huang Po river.
